The El Valle Study: Seasons of Tradition and Change
FAIN: GY-10153-73
Lisa Gray, Jr
Unaffiliated independent scholar
To record, reinforce, and preserve the traditions of an isolated village in northern New Mexico, and in doing so, reaffirm the significance of tradition in all areas of the country. To strengthen the interest of young people in the heritage and history of Spanish- and Mexican-Americans, foster insight into and respect for the culture, and to encourage similar efforts by others close to the mainstream of this tradition.
